什么是Vue页面?
Vue是一种流行的JavaScript框架,被广泛用于构建现代化的单页应用程序(SPA)。Vue页面是使用Vue.js框架创建的动态、交互式和高性能的网页。
为什么选择Vue.js作为页面开发框架?

Vue.js是一种简单易用、灵活性强的前端框架,具有以下几个重要优点:
- 轻量级:Vue.js的文件大小相对较小,加载速度快,有利于提高页面性能。
- 易学易用:Vue.js提供了简单直观的API和文档,使得开发者可以快速上手。
- 响应式设计:Vue.js使用了类似于Angular的数据绑定机制,可以轻松实现页面数据的实时更新。
- 组件化开发:Vue.js鼓励将页面拆分为多个可重用组件,便于管理和维护。
- 社区支持:Vue.js拥有庞大的社区支持,可以轻松找到解决问题的资源和插件。
如何优化Vue页面的性能?
优化Vue页面的性能可以提升用户体验,提高加载速度和交互响应能力。以下是一些优化方法:
1. 使用虚拟DOM(Virtual DOM)
Vue.js通过使用虚拟DOM来追踪和管理页面的变化,从而减少真实DOM的操作次数,提高页面性能。
2. 懒加载(Lazy Load)
对于页面上的大型图片或资源,可以使用懒加载技术,延迟加载这些资源,减少初始页面加载时间。
3. 代码分割(Code Splitting)
将页面的代码分割成多个小块,按需加载,可以避免一次性加载大量的代码,提高页面加载速度。
4. 缓存优化
使用适当的缓存策略,例如在组件中使用缓存指令,在网络请求中使用缓存机制,可以减少不必要的数据请求,提高页面的响应速度。
5. 避免不必要的重渲染
在Vue.js中,每次数据变化都会触发组件的重新渲染。为了避免不必要的性能损耗,可以使用v-if和v-show等指令来控制组件的显示和隐藏。
为什么对Vue页面进行性能优化很重要?
优化Vue页面的性能对于提供良好的用户体验和满足现代网页应用程序的要求非常重要。高性能的页面可以获得更好的加载速度、交互响应和用户满意度。
常见问题 - Vue页面优化FAQs
问题1:如何判断一个Vue页面的性能是否需要优化?
答案1:如果页面加载速度缓慢,交互响应慢,或者存在明显的卡顿和延迟现象,就需要考虑对Vue页面进行性能优化。
问题2:除了上述提到的方法,还有没有其他可以提高Vue页面性能的技巧?
答案2:是的,还有很多其他的技巧可以提高Vue页面的性能,例如使用Webpack进行打包优化、合理使用异步组件等。
问题3:如何避免Vue页面的内存泄漏问题?
答案3:可以注意及时销毁不再使用的Vue实例、手动解绑事件和定时器、使用Vue Devtools进行性能检测等方法来避免内存泄漏问题。
问题4:Vue页面的性能优化会带来什么好处?
答案4:优化Vue页面的性能可以提高用户体验、降低用户流失率、加快页面的加载速度,从而提升网站的转化率和用户满意度。
问题5:Vue.js与React相比,哪个更适合进行页面开发?
答案5:Vue.js和React都是优秀的前端框架,具有各自的特点和优点。具体选择哪个框架取决于项目的需求和团队的技术储备。
结论
Vue页面的优化对于提高用户体验和页面性能非常重要。通过合理使用优化技巧和遵循最佳实践,可以提高Vue页面的加载速度、交互响应和用户满意度。